What affects the price

When you are budgeting for drywall, the final number depends on a few specific factors. The size of the room is the biggest driver, but the complexity of the installation matters just as much. For example, high ceilings, intricate corners, or tight spaces require more labor time. If you need special moisture-resistant boards for a bathroom or fire-rated panels for a garage, material costs will shift accordingly. About this service

Drywall corner bead is a rigid strip made of metal or vinyl that is installed on the sharp corners of walls. It protects the edges from getting dented and provides a perfectly straight line for the wall. You need it whenever you have an outside corner, such as where two walls meet at a 90-degree angle. It is essential for creating clean, crisp edges that can withstand everyday bumps and scrapes in high-traffic areas.

Is there a difference between drywall and sheetrock?

Sheetrock is simply a specific brand name for drywall, but many people in Spokane use the terms interchangeably. Both serve as the primary wallboard for interiors in Spokane homes.
